Hyundai Auto Insurance Monthly Rates: Comparing Minimum and Full Coverage

When it comes to insuring your Hyundai, understanding the cost of coverage is essential. Below is a table detailing the monthly rates for minimum and full coverage from top insurance providers.

Hyundai Auto Insurance Monthly Rates by Coverage Level & Provider
Insurance CompanyMinimum CoverageFull Coverage
Allstate$55$140
American Family$58$148
Farmers$57$145
Geico$48$125
Liberty Mutual$52$135
Nationwide$53$138
Progressive$45$120
State Farm$50$130
The Hartford$61$155
Travelers$60$150

The rates for minimum coverage vary among providers, with Progressive offering the lowest at $45 per month and American Family the highest at $58. For full coverage, Geico offers the most affordable option at $125 per month, while The Hartford has the highest rate at $155. More information is available about this provider in our “Affordable Full Coverage Auto Insurance.”

These rates are based on factors such as the model of the Hyundai and the driver’s profile, so it’s important to compare quotes to find the best rate for your specific needs.

Understanding the Different Types of Hyundai Auto Insurance Coverage

Auto insurance exists to protect drivers and their vehicles and is required in most states. When purchasing auto insurance, most drivers choose between liability, comprehensive, collision, uninsured motorist, personal injury protection, and gap insurance. Most insurance companies offer each of these coverages in addition to various optional coverages. 

  • Liability Insurance: Liability insurance, which is required by almost all states, covers bodily injury and property damage expenses for other drivers and passengers involved in an accident you caused, up to a certain limit. 
  • Comprehensive Insurance: Comprehensive insurance covers non-collision damage to your vehicle, such as weather, theft, vandalism, fire, and animal collisions. Lenders and dealerships often require this for leased or financed vehicles.There is a key difference between comprehensive and collision coverage, which is detailed below.
  • Collision Insurance: Covers property damage after a vehicle has collided with another vehicle or object. Similar to comprehensive insurance, lenders and dealerships may require drivers to purchase collision insurance for leased or financed vehicles.   
  • Uninsured Motorist: Some drivers have no insurance, or their coverage limit doesn’t cover the full cost of bodily injury or property damage. Uninsured/underinsured motorist insurance, which is required in select states, covers bodily injury and/or property damage expenses when the at-fault driver is uninsured or underinsured. 
  • Personal Injury Protection (PIP): Depending on the state, it is required to cover both the driver and their passengers’ medical expenses, lost wages, replacement services, and funeral expenses, regardless of who is at fault for an accident. 
  • Gap Insurance: Pays the difference between the totaled vehicle’s value and the remaining loan or lease balance. For example, if your Hyundai Elantra is worth $9,000, and the remaining loan balance is $12,500, if your vehicle is totaled, gap insurance covers the $3,500 difference. 

Two considerations to keep in mind when choosing your insurance coverage are coverage limits and deductibles. 

In states where liability insurance is mandated, drivers are expected to have a certain amount of coverage. Regardless of states, the coverage limits are displayed as three different numbers. If you see 25/50/20, this means your liability insurance will cover $25,000 bodily injury liability per person, $50,000 bodily injury liability per accident, and $20,000 property damage liability.

Comprehensive collision and sometimes personal injury protection carry a deductible. An auto insurance deductible is the amount of the cost of repairs the policyholder is asked to pay before insurance steps in.

For example, if your chosen deductible is $750 and an accident caused $1,500 in property damage, your insurance company pays the remaining balance of the repair bill, which would be $750.  However, the auto insurance company will pay out the value of the vehicle, minus the deductible, for totaled vehicles.

Common Discounts Provided by Auto Insurance Companies

In today’s digital age, insurance companies offer a variety of cost-saving options for policyholders. The following are the few common discounts offered by auto insurance companies.

  • Paperless: Policyholders can save by receiving auto insurance documents online instead of through the mail.
  • Good Student: Policyholders can save by having high school and college drivers with good grades on their policies. 
  • Multi-Policy: Policyholders can save by purchasing more than one insurance policy, such as home and auto. 
  • Multi-Car: Policyholders can save by purchasing insurance for two or more vehicles.
  • Auto Pay:  Policyholders can save by having their premium payments deducted from their payment account automatically. 
  • Paid-In-Full: Policyholders can save by paying their auto insurance premium in one payment.
